An artificial intelligence tool is helping to detect chest issues, which could indicate lung cancer, in a matter of seconds. It's now in use in forty countries around the world. It's called Annalise AI, and we speak to the co-founder of the company behind it.
Also on Tech Life:
In Kenya, Direct Air Capture technology is being designed, manufactured and deployed in the vast Rift valley.
And the commute of the future is being mapped out and planned today - find out about digital twinning.
